Following the first official poster that debuted yesterday, Sony Pictures has unveiled the first trailer and two photos for Chappie, director Neill Blomkamp's highly-anticipated follow-up to last year's Elysium.

Sharlto Copley, who has starred in Neill Blomkamp's District 9 and Elysium, lends his voice to the title character, a robot who is kidnapped at "birth" by two South African gangsters, played by musicians Yo-landi Visser and Ninja from the group Die Antwoord, Chappie grows up in this dysfunctional family of criminals. Unlike most robots, Chappie actually has original ideas, and he is programmed to paint pictures and write poetry.

The cast also includes A-list additions such as Hugh Jackman as an anti-A.I. emissary who wants to destroy Chappie and Dev Patel as a young scientist who has a breakthrough that results in an unexpected surprise for his company. Sigourney Weaver also stars, along with Jose Pablo Cantillo and Brandon Auret in what could be one of next year's earliest hits, arriving in theaters on March 27, 2015.
